Detailed Description

The NE555 Timer IC is one of the most widely used integrated circuits in electronics due to its versatility, reliability, and ease of use. It can be configured to generate precise time delays, oscillations, and pulse-width modulation (PWM) signals.

In monostable mode, it produces a single output pulse in response to a trigger signal. In astable mode, it functions as an oscillator generating continuous square waves, and in bistable mode, it acts as a flip-flop. This flexibility makes the NE555 suitable for a wide range of applications, from simple LED blinking circuits to complex timing and control systems.

The NE555 is commonly used in educational kits, Arduino projects, motor control circuits, sound generators, and timer-based automation systems. Its robust design allows operation in various electronic environments.

Technical Specifications

IC Type: Timer / Oscillator

Model: NE555

Supply Voltage Range: 4.5V – 15V DC

Output Current: Up to 200 mA

Timing Range: Microseconds to hours (depending on external components)

Operating Temperature: 0°C – 70°C

Package Type: DIP-8 / SOIC-8

Trigger/Input Logic Levels: TTL compatible
